Measuring Success for Individual Scholarship Recipients The Scholarship to Assist Continuing Undergraduate Students grant, funded by Non-Profit Organizations, aims to support students who demonstrate strong academic promise and financial need. To ensure the effectiveness of this grant, it is crucial to establish a robust measurement framework that assesses the outcomes of individual recipients. ### Required Outcomes and KPIs To measure the success of individual scholarship recipients, the funder requires the tracking of specific outcomes and Key Performance Indicators (KPIs). These may include academic performance metrics, such as GPA and graduation rates, as well as indicators of financial stability and self-sufficiency. For instance, the funder may require recipients to maintain a minimum GPA of 3.0 or higher to remain eligible for the scholarship. Additionally, the funder may track the percentage of recipients who secure employment in their field of study within a certain timeframe after graduation. The funder's emphasis on 'hardship grants for individuals' and 'government grants for individuals' underscores the importance of assessing the financial well-being of recipients. To this end, the measurement framework may include KPIs such as the reduction in financial stress or the increase in financial literacy among recipients. By tracking these outcomes, the funder can evaluate the effectiveness of the grant in supporting individual students and make informed decisions about future funding. ### Reporting Requirements and Delivery Challenges To ensure compliance with the grant's reporting requirements, recipients and administrators must be aware of the specific data collection and reporting needs. This may involve regular progress reports, financial statements, and academic transcripts. One verifiable delivery challenge unique to this sector is the need to balance the administrative burden of reporting with the need to support recipients in achieving their academic goals. Effective management of this challenge requires streamlined reporting processes and clear communication between recipients, administrators, and the funder. One concrete regulation that applies to this sector is the requirement to comply with the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A) when collecting and reporting student data. This regulation ensures the protection of sensitive student information and underscores the importance of data security and confidentiality in the measurement framework. In terms of eligibility barriers, applicants must be continuing undergraduate students who demonstrate financial need and strong academic promise. To avoid compliance traps, administrators must ensure that recipients meet these eligibility criteria and adhere to the grant's reporting requirements. It is also essential to note that the grant does not fund certain activities or expenses, such as tuition for students who have already completed their degree or expenses unrelated to academic pursuits.
